Doctors who conduct ADHD evaluations

The first step to get an ADHD evaluation is finding an expert who is capable of understanding your issues. A professional should be compassionate and tolerant, but knowledgeable about ADHD and the various treatment options available. It may take a few appointments to find a person who is comfortable with your concerns and is able to answer all your questions. Before deciding on a specialist it is essential to determine the cost and insurance coverage.

During the examination, the doctor will ask you questions to learn more about your conditions. They will ask you how to get a private adhd assessment they affect your work, relationships, and your daily life. They will want to know whether you've had them for a lengthy period of. Most often doctors will ask other people in your life to provide their input too. You might ask your spouse sibling, parent or teacher for adults or a daycare worker, coach or teacher for children. Personal experience can provide crucial information that isn't available from questionnaires.

In addition to the interview, the doctor will review the medical history and check the adult or child for signs of ADHD. They will also determine whether symptoms are present in different environments, such as school and at home. Evaluation process

It's important to have an accurate assessment conducted if you suspect you or your child may suffer from ADHD. This will help you determine the cause of the problem and how it can be treated. It will also make sure that you're receiving the best treatment possible.

A doctor or nurse will interview you as part of the ADHD assessment process. They will ask you questions about your symptoms and how they affect your life. The questionnaires can be used to collect additional details about your issue. Your answers must be truthful to ensure that the evaluation is accurate.

You will be asked for information about your family background as well as any mental health issues you might have faced in the past. This information helps your provider determine if your symptoms may be due to a coexisting disorder or other factors, such as pregnancy or medication.
